What is Pump Vibration Analysis?
Pump vibration analysis measures and monitors vibrations to identify irregularities that may signal mechanical issues. This technique detects early-stage problems such as:
- Cavitation
- Loose components
- Misalignment
- Unbalance
- Worn or damaged components
Pump vibration analysis is a valuable predictive maintenance tool for identifying mechanical flaws and assessing a pump’s operating condition.

Why Vibration Analysis Matters in Data Centers
Cooling is the second-most energy-consuming aspect of a data center, after IT-related energy consumption. Pumps have several critical functions in a data center, helping do the following:
- Distribute chilled water, helping to cool the ambient temperatures of rooms housing critical equipment
- Remove condenser water from data halls to chillers, cooling towers, and dry coolers
- Circulate fluids and coolants to direct-to-chip cooling systems
- Support water recycling and chemical treatment initiatives
Pump vibrations can reduce performance, efficiency, and longevity, all of which are essential for sustaining operations, maximizing uptime, and avoiding costly repairs or SLA penalties.
